Well, she ran on the pond this week and generally was ok. A couple of things need sorting though and maybe somebody has some pointers.

1) Its not as fast as i was lead to believe it would be, it will not plane though is a pretty quick almost plane.

2) The radio range was dreadful (Acoms) measured as only 40 feet odd? The aerial is not connected because it was thought the wire running under the deck would be fine.

3) When it is at its range limit the speed controller stops and starts, in addition sometimes using the rudder causes speed control issues.

Any help to resolve these issues would be great, I am new to r/c.

Teething troubles

It is difficult to comment on your speed/planing issue without knowing the boat,motor and batteries.

Regarding the radio issue the usual rule is that if it is in sight it is within range - therefore if you are only getting 40 feet you have a problem!

Have you fitted suppressors to your motor? If not do so.

Usually the way you have fitted your aerial is fine - assuming you have not cut it which is a no no.Try fitting a small section vertically by putting it inside a short section of hollow plastic tube and fixing it through the deck.

The other radio problem of fluttering rudder and interferance between channels could be caused by someone else on your frequency or not enough power in the battery.I always use a separate receiver battery rather than BEC but thats just me and many people do as you do.
